#696d4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#696d4c is composed of 41.2% red, 42.7%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.3%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 67.3 degrees, a saturation of 17.8% and a lightness of 36.3%. #696d4c color hex could be obtained by blending #d2da98 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#696d4c color description : Very dark grayish yellow.
#696d4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#696d4c has RGB values of R:105, G:109,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 6909260.

Shades and Tints of #696d4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050503 is the darkest color, while #fafa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#696d4c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5f5a is the less saturated color, while #9fb405 is the most saturated one.
